这应该是一个重复的问题,但我无法找到答案.我想在启动ClickOnce安装程序的Vista任务计划程序中添加一个任务.据我所知,该应用程序的.exe是隐藏的?所以我尝试输入桌面快捷方式作为要在"操作"选项卡中启动的项目.但这不起作用.我收到一条错误消息,指出快捷方式是无效的win32应用程序.
现在怎么办?
我对编码比较陌生; 我的大多数"工作"都只是简单的GUI应用程序,它只能用于一件事,所以我没有必要进行多少操作.
无论如何,我想知道线程的一件事是,如果你想让一个线程永远活着去做它正在做的任何工作(处理,等待输入,等等),那么格式化它是正常的:
while (true) {
// do stuff
Thread.Sleep(1000);
}
Run Code Online (Sandbox Code Playgroud)
(或类似的规定)...?或者这是不安全的,如果可能的话应该避免吗?
我一直在用Python捣乱,我收集到它通常更好(或'pythonic')使用
for x in SomeArray:
Run Code Online (Sandbox Code Playgroud)
而不是更多的C风格
for i in range(0, len(SomeArray)):
Run Code Online (Sandbox Code Playgroud)
我确实看到了这方面的好处,主要是更清晰的代码,以及使用漂亮map()和相关功能的能力.但是,我经常遇到这样的情况:我想同时访问数组中不同偏移的元素.例如,我可能想要将当前元素添加到元素后面两步.有没有办法在不诉诸显式指数的情况下做到这一点?
所以我正在使用SPIM模拟器学习MIPS并且我坚持这个问题.
我想添加两个64位数字,存储在四个32位寄存器中.所以我添加了LO字节,然后是进位和HI字节.但是没有adc/addc命令,即添加进位.
所以我必须在状态寄存器中添加进位.但是,我究竟如何阅读这个寄存器?
如果$ t0是临时寄存器1,那么持有进位标志的状态寄存器的等价物是什么?
我google了很多,我仍然找不到任何甚至使用状态寄存器的例子.
建议您在日常工作中发现一些有用的插件.
Eclipse CDT存储库:
http://download.eclipse.org/releases/helioshttp://download.eclipse.org/tools/cdt/releases/helios插件:
http://subclipse.tigris.org/update_1.6.x http://download.eclipse.org/technology/linuxtools/updatehttp://www.cmakebuilder.com/updatehttp://cmakeed.sourceforge.net/updatesInstallation instructions linkhttp://eclipsecorba.sourceforge.net/update请添加一个带有eclipse更新URL的插件进行发布.
我正在尝试使用视图来使用视图创建ADO.NET实体.但是,该视图没有一个非NULL的列.
我遇到的一件事是在视图上创建一个NOT NULL列,以用作视图的"主键".这有效,但该字段仍然报告为NULL.
有没有办法强制或欺骗SQL Server将该视图列报告为NOT NULL?
想象一下这样的观点:
CREATE VIEW vwSample WITH SCHEMABINDING
AS
SELECT ID = convert(uniqueidentifier, /* some computed value */)
,Field1
,Field2
,Field3
FROM tbSample
Run Code Online (Sandbox Code Playgroud)
注: 说我可以编辑XML实体做这样的事情之前,我问这是因为我有一个非常要创建大量实体的这种方式.
我有一个简单的Perl脚本,它使用无限循环作为Linux守护进程运行.它每10秒连接一个数据库以执行一个进程.
while (1)
{
# THIS LINE WILL KILL THE SCRIPT IF IT FAILS
my $DB=DBI->connect("dbi:Sybase:server=myserver","user","password");
. . . do something . . .
sleep (10);
}
Run Code Online (Sandbox Code Playgroud)
我有两个问题:
我想知道如何识别标签栏中的项目?
我有一个包含NAvigationController的tabBarController,如下所示:
NSMutableArray *localViewControllersArray = [[NSMutableArray alloc] initWithCapacity:6];
Run Code Online (Sandbox Code Playgroud)
每个navigationController都在这个数组中.
我使用以下方法管理每个标签栏项目中的操作:
- tabBarController:(UITabBarController*)tabBarController didSelectViewController:(UIViewController*)viewController
Run Code Online (Sandbox Code Playgroud)
而我在这种方法中,即:
if (viewController == [self.tabBarController.viewControllers objectAtIndex:0])
Run Code Online (Sandbox Code Playgroud)
像这样我识别我点击的标签栏项目.
但问题是你可以编辑iphone屏幕中的Tabbar(因为数组中有6个viewControllers初始化tabbar)然后,我使用的方式不正确,因为我可以改变viewcontrollers的位置在我使用此编辑工具时在标签栏中.
谢谢
在矩阵报告中,是否可以根据父组的值隐藏列?例如,我有一个名为"value"的列,当包含它的列组具有特定值时,我想隐藏它.